Continuing the orange discussion well beyond what it's worth...

> back in 80-83. just like there's blue, and then there's Blue, there are > different versions of Orange. even Bobo would have to agree with that. :) >

Yes this is true. And Bobo even contains two versions of orange himself where the previous owner (rightly) decided that the green engine hatch clashed with the overall paint scheme and painted the engine hatch orange. Unfortunately, the only orange paint he could get his hands on was some cans of orange spray paint. Even though he did a truly professional job (no drips, runs, or orange-peels), Bobo's butt is definately a different shade of orange, as is a spot on his nose. It DOES look better than green, but if it's daylight you can tell that the colors don't match. Oh well, it adds personality.

So if you see an orange and white `74 bus with a lighter-orange engine hatch driving around in Oregon it might be Bobo.
